Outline of Final Research Achievements |
The aim of this research project was to develop a tactile stimulus presentation device to evaluation of pain sensation caused by hypoesthesia tactile perception due to lifestyle-related diseases. First, this study conducted an interview survey of medical staffs to obtain knowledge on the perceptuals and cognitive processes of patients' verbal expressions of pain sansation. Next, we carried out an experiment to determine the problems with the pain testing method, and showed the factors that reduce the amount of stimulation due to the examiner's manual operation and the number of compressions. Then, we developed a new tactile sensory measurement device capable of early detection of somatosensory impairment, and compared factors such as posture and age. In conclusions, this research project obtained knowledge for use in clinical practice based on these results.
